    An infantryman from the 1st Battalion, 21st Infantry Regiment, 2nd Infantry Brigade Combat Team, 25th Infantry Division, scans his sector of fire with a M240B Machine Gun during the Fire Support Coordination Exercise (FSCX) on November 14, 2019 at Pohakuloa Training Area, Hawaii. The FSCX is one of the most realistic training events provided to Soldiers and junior leaders through testing of the unit’s integration of maneuvers, fire support and all enabler assets.
